Location: Calgary, AlbertaType: In the OfficeTroy Life & Fire Safety Ltd. is one of the largest suppliers of Fire Alarm, Fire Suppression, Security, Nurse call and Communications Systems in Canada. As an Edwards Authorized National Partner, Troy is proudly Canadian. We are an employee-owned company with over 1300 people in 28 locations coast to coast. An entrepreneurial company with a legacy of success, we pride ourselves on having a team of industry leading talent and an exciting plan for the future. Troy is a 2025 winner of the Canada's Best Managed Companies program.Our Calgary, AB branch is looking for an enthusiastic Office Administrator to join our team! The ideal candidate will be someone with proficient communication skills, strong typing skills, proven ability to pr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ment and committed to providing the best support possible to ongoing objectives of the company.ResponsibilitiesProvide administrative support to the Fire and Sprinkler side of the businessComplete data management processes; filing and uploading documentation into ERP systemAssisting with reports, invoicing, inventory transactions and quotes including distribution and uploadingCoordinate the return of damaged material to suppliers for creditCustomer service duties, including reception duties on a back-up basisAccounts payable processing and other administrative tasks as requiredQualifications:Strong typing skills with excellent attention to detailPost-Secondary Education in Business Administration or related field; or 3-5 years' working experience in office administrationAbility to multi-task and be a versatile team memberProficient in Microsoft Office Programs (PowerPoint, Word, Excel and Outlook)Experience in ERP/Data Management/HRIS Systems and advanced computer ability considered a strong assetIndustry experience in Fire and Life Safety considered and asset but not requiredStrong organizational skills are requiredWe are looking for someone with positive interpersonal skills and an ability to work well in a team environment, as well as independentlyWhy Work With Troy?Troy offers an excellent compensation package including a comprehensive benefits program and paid sick days.
